We’re looking for a Product Manager to join Jira and help us drive the mission to scale our enterprise story. You will have a chance to build functionalities in Jira and help the Jira administrators administer Jira using AI and agents at enterprise scale. If you are interested in solving complex problems, creating the future in AI and delivering real business outcomes through your product releases then this is the role for you.

More about you; You love working closely with customers and building amazing products that our customers love. You have prior success delivering functionalities and evangelising for customers but you also want to own the outcomes and the product that you manage from soup to nuts. You are a product leader

Effective in prioritising, setting clear goals, making decisions, and communicating crisply to all audiences. You’ve got charisma in spades: you’re social and adept at building relationships across product lines and functional groups to make sure we are all on the same page.

Responsibilities

- Drive the AI led roadmap to delivering scalable and easy to use products and tools to help Jira administrators drive success and growth within their organisation. You are the PM that is savvy with agents, LLMS, AI and are also able to learn complex concepts around how configuration of Jira should evolve.
- Product Research and POV formulation
- Understand a customer’s journey and use cases in a Jira to create a solid roadmap of initiative.
- Define and drive a product roadmap along with other PMs, and to communicate this to teams and leadership as appropriate.
- Conduct customer research, market research and competitive analysis to identify opportunities and inform the product roadmap
- Gather and analyse user feedback through various channels to inform product decisions and improve user experience.
- Product Execution
- Lead the product development lifecycle from ideation to launch, ensuring timely delivery and high-quality standards. Work closely with cross-functional teams including engineering, design, program management, marketing and sales to develop and launch new features
- Collaborate with stakeholders to align product goals with business objectives.
- Utilise data and analytics to measure product performance, identify areas for improvement or experimentation, and drive product decisions in alignment with the organisational goals
- Align with other PM's and cross-functional teams to ensure alignment of priorities and dependencies

On your first day we’ll expect you to have

Must have:

- Good experience working with AI products and thinking AI first
- Good instincts matched with analytical thinking. Comfortable making decisions based on both qualitative and quantitative data, and hustle to get that data
- Cross-functional stakeholder management skills to drive your team/s towards product goals
- True obsession for customers – you go out of your way to talk to customers and solve their problems because it’s what gets you out of bed in the morning, even if it means a tough conversation

Nice to have but a big bonus

- Product management experience from a fast-growing software company
- Prioritisation skills, evaluating opportunities against the needs of our customers and our business, and clearly communicating rationale behind your decisions
- Experience translating technical trade offs into clear, concrete, customer-facing product goals
- Understanding of good product usability, how it’s assessed and how to drive the team towards developing delightful experiences

Qualifications

It’s great, but not required, if you have

- 1+ years of product management experience
- Computer science or a related technical degree, MBA or startup experience a bonus
